Lionsgate announced Monday that “La La Land In Concert: A Live-to-Film Celebration” will come to the Hollywood Bowl on May 26-27. The live shows with a 100-piece symphony orchestra, choir and jazz ensemble will be conducted by composer Justin Hurwitz, and will feature the film’s original vocal recordings from Ryan Gosling, Emma Stone and John Legend. “La La Land” won six Academy Awards, including best original score and best original song for Hurwitz.
